ServiceNow (NYSE:NOW) Rating Reiterated by Guggenheim

Guggenheim reiterated their neutral rating on shares of ServiceNow (NYSE:NOWFree Report) in a report issued on Monday morning, Marketbeat Ratings reports.

Other equities analysts have also recently issued reports about the stock. Barclays upped their price target on shares of ServiceNow from $765.00 to $870.00 and gave the company an overweight rating in a research report on Tuesday, January 23rd. Mizuho increased their price objective on shares of ServiceNow from $750.00 to $820.00 and gave the stock a buy rating in a research report on Thursday, January 25th. Needham & Company LLC increased their price objective on shares of ServiceNow from $660.00 to $900.00 and gave the stock a buy rating in a research report on Monday, January 22nd. BMO Capital Markets increased their price objective on shares of ServiceNow from $630.00 to $850.00 and gave the stock an outperform rating in a research report on Thursday, January 25th. Finally, Stifel Nicolaus reiterated a buy rating and set a $820.00 price objective on shares of ServiceNow in a research report on Wednesday, March 20th. Three invest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and twenty-three have given a buy r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at, the company has a consensus rating of Moderate Buy and an average target price of $780.00.

ServiceNow Trading Down 1.2 %

Shares of NYSE NOW opened at $735.68 on Monday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.20, a quick ratio of 1.06 and a current ratio of 1.06. ServiceNow has a 52-week low of $427.68 and a 52-week high of $815.32. The firm has a 50 day moving average price of $767.53 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$700.42. The stock has a market cap of $151.09 billion, a P/E ratio of 87.48,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 4.65 and a beta of 0.97.

ServiceNow (NYSE:NOWG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, January 24th. The information technology services provider reported $3.11 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.77 by $0.34. ServiceNow had a net margin of 19.30% and a return on equity of 11.85%. The firm had revenue of $2.44 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.40 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$0.88 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 25.6%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ities analysts forecast that ServiceNow will post 6.16 EPS for the current year.

About ServiceNow

(Get Free Report)

ServiceNow, Inc provides end to-end intelligent workflow automation platform solutions for digital businesses in the North America, Europe, the Middle East and Africa, Asia Pacific, and internationally. The company operates the Now platform for end-to-end digital transformation, artificial intelligence, machine learning, robotic process automation, process mining, performance analytics, and collaboration and development tools.
